Bello just opened taking over Popolo. Wasn’t a fan of the previous place’s Sicilian-style thick pizza slices. Meanwhile I never tried Bello when they in Bloor West Village. So seeing them open here was a welcome surprise.

Had a slice of their mushroom and weekly special sausage and peppers ($8 each). Not bad. Firstly, the slices are on the larger side. Combined with the generous amount of toppings (especially cheese) the slices are noticeably heavier too than the usual. The crust was crispy and firm, but not too thick. Wish it had a bit more chew (like Badiali’s or Mac’s).

Definitely better than Popolo overall. And compared to the only decent pizza slice place nearby, Maker’s, Bello wins for slice size and topping quality and quantity. But I prefer Maker’s crust and at half the price.
